This week we’re back with a nice smattering of weird and disturbing stories. The number of workers who believe their boss cares about them has plummeted in the last year, which is pretty obvious given that an Applebee’s franchising executive recently expounded the virtues of worker suffering for his bottom line. Saudi Arabia is considering accepting Chinese yuan for oil, which, like, hello? We’ve been backing you up for years, and this is how you treat us? Wow. In related news, Antarctica saw an unexplainable spike in temperature that has climate scientists confused and very, very concerned. Ginni Thomas’ unhinged texts to Mark Meadows reveal the degree of the elites’ disconnection from reality. Biden shouldn’t have said that, and Boston is making its busses free for the next two years.
